Senate Appropriations Government Operations panel reviews House Bill 1015 budget amendments for OMB, weighs funding restorations and new pools
Summary
The Senate Appropriations Government Operations Division met to review House Bill 1015 (Office of Management and Budget) and discuss restoring several line items, creating a deferred maintenance fund, topping up personnel pools, and options for state hospital project oversight. No formal votes were recorded in the transcript.
The Senate Appropriations Government Operations Division on Thursday reviewed House Bill 1015, the biennial budget for the Office of Management and Budget, and discussed restoring funding cut by the House, establishing a deferred maintenance fund, and provisioning personnel pools to cover retirement and vacant-position costs.
Chairman Wannsaker convened the panel and said the committee would focus solely on the OMB budget. Brady, a staff member assisting the committee, summarized the items under discussion, and urged members to consider restoring several reductions and accommodating new and vacant FTE and retirement pools.
Why it matters: the committee’s decisions will determine whether several one-time and ongoing budget adjustments reach the final appropriation, including a proposed deferred-maintenance pool, a restoration of grants, and funding set-asides intended to prevent late-biennium shortfalls in agency salary lines.
